Output 928f7b89e28d8a0b690f43f59901df93372876ead981e96310d147b93adbafaf:0

value
71589366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80ace23b21298948bc04e38ddef4bc9634778ac OP_EQUAL
address
3MPLpjrzvKG6TsYcXU3YvEPWYzYa5gJMUV
transaction
928f7b89e28d8a0b690f43f59901df93372876ead981e96310d147b93adbafaf
confirmations
177786
spent
true